The Role
We are seeking an experienced and motivated Assessor to join our team, supporting learners to achieve their full potential through high-quality training and assessment. The successful candidate will play a key role in delivering apprenticeship programmes, managing a caseload of learners, and working closely with employers to ensure the effective development of knowledge, skills and behaviours in line with relevant standards.
Key Responsibilities
- To plan, conduct and participate in induction and initial assessment of learners to identify realistic learning priorities and, in liaison with the employer, develop individual learning plans and agree realistic completion targets. This will include ensuring that employers have a full understanding of the requirement for Apprentices to complete off the job training.
- To provide information, advice and guidance to learners and employers to promote learning and timely achievement of the agreed learning aims and SMART objectives.
- Assessment of knowledge, skills and behaviours, and the delivery and assessment of Functional Skills and competencies within the NVQ programme.
- To maintain a minimum caseload of learners. Assist them to achieve NVQ qualifications and the Apprenticeship Standard and prepare them for End Point Assessment.
- Promote positive attitudes to diversity through your training and assessment practice.
